Discover Aliens Games Daily
Discover New Aliens Games Releases
X-Morph: Defense
Unique fusion of a top-down shooter and tower defense strategy. You are the invader! Use destructive weapons or lead your enemies into a maze of towers. Strategize in the build mode by carefully selecting various types of alien towers or throw yourself right into the heat of the battle.
Iron Marines
Real-time strategy battles in amazing sci-fi worlds! Command brave soldiers, mighty mechas and powerful aliens to face the greatest challenges in hostile alien worlds. The galaxy needs you!
Shortest Trip to Earth
Shortest Trip to Earth is a roguelike spaceship simulator focused on exploration, ship management and tactical battles. Embark on a perilous journey across the universe with nuclear missiles, armed crew and a cat.
Warhammer 40,000: Armageddon
In this hex-based, turn-based strategy game, players will lead the Imperial forces of the Armageddon Steel Legion and Space Marines from a variety of Chapters against the Ork invasion through over 30 scenarios, on the hostile terrain of the planet and its gigantic Hive Cities.
SPORE™ Creepy & Cute Parts Pack
Add horror and humor to your universe. Make grotesque beasts or cuddly critters, then watch them do the robot, zombie walk, break dance and more! Includes over 100 new items. 60 New parts 48 New paint options 24 New animations
Infested Planet
Command a team of 5 elite soldiers against an alien horde of 100,000. Surrounded on all sides, you must outmaneuver and outsmart the enemy.
DG2: Defense Grid 2
Setting the bar as the definitive tower defense game, Defense Grid 2 introduces new worlds and threats to test your tower placement strategies. With a bold new look and the addition of new game modes, player-versus-player and multiplayer co-op, every play brings fun new opportunities and challenges.
Defense Grid: The Awakening
Defense Grid: The Awakening is a unique spin on tower defense gameplay that will appeal to players of all skill levels. A horde of enemies is invading, and it's up to the player to stop them by strategically building fortification towers around their base.
The Bureau: XCOM Declassified
The year is 1962 and the Cold War has the nation gripped by fear. A top-secret government unit called The Bureau begins investigating a series of mysterious attacks by an enemy more powerful than communism.
X-COM: UFO Defense
You are in control of X-COM: an organization formed by the world's governments to fight the ever-increasing alien menace.
The Riftbreaker: Prologue
The Riftbreaker: Prologue allows you to experience the events taking place before the story campaign of the main game. Explore an entirely new world. Gather resources. Build up a base. Defend yourself from thousands of alien creatures.
ENDLESS™ Space - Definitive Edition
Endless Space is a turn-based 4X strategy game, covering the space colonization age in the Endless universe, where you can control every aspect of your civilization as you strive for galactic domination.
STAR WARS™ Battlefront
The STAR WARS™ Battlefront™ Ultimate Edition includes the STAR WARS™ Battlefront™ Deluxe Edition as well as the STAR WARS™ Battlefront™ Season Pass.
The Universim
Jump straight into managing your own planets as you guide a civilization through the ages. Build the ultimate empire in The Universim, a new breed of God Game in development by Crytivo.
Shadow Empire
Shadow Empire is a deep turn-based 4X wargame with a unique blend of military focus, procedurally generated content and role-playing features.
Xenonauts
Xenonauts is a strategy game in which you control a multi-national military organisation defending a Cold War-era Earth from alien invasion, using small squads of persistent soldiers to eliminate the extraterrestrials and recover their technology in turn-based ground combat.
Operation: New Earth
Operation: New Earth is an intense sci-fi multiplayer strategy game in which you must command an advanced military facility to defend Earth from a hostile alien invasion. Create an alliance, gather resources, and unlock advanced technology to level up your stronghold!
Galactic Civilizations III
Build a civilization that will stand the test of time in the largest space-based strategy game ever! Choose from dozens of unique races and make a name for yourself across the galaxy through diplomacy, espionage, technological advances, and more.